How to Redeem Warframe Codes 

You can redeem codes for Warframe on the official website, not in the game. Here’s the exact process:

Step-by-Step Redemption Guide

  1. Go to warframe.com on your browser.
  2. Log in to your Warframe account using your registered email and password.
  3. Click on your username in the top-right corner of the page.
  4. Select “Redeem Code” from the dropdown menu.
  5. Type your code exactly as shown — spelling and capitalization matter.
  6. Click Submit and wait for the success message.
  7. Launch Warframe and claim your rewards from your in-game inbox.

What Rewards Can You Get From Warframe Codes?

Warframe codes cover several types of in-game rewards. Here’s what each one does for your build and progression:

Boosters

Boosters are the most common reward. They temporarily double your Credit or Affinity gains. These are useful during farming sessions or when leveling new Warframes.

Glyphs and Cosmetics

Some codes unlock exclusive glyphs — player icons that show up in your profile and loadout. These cosmetics can’t always be earned through normal gameplay.

Mod Packs

Mod packs give you a batch of random or curated mods. These are perfect for new players who want to grow their collection or find specific build parts.

Sigils

Sigils are cosmetic overlays for your Warframe. Some are only available through promotional codes and limited-time events.

Twitch Drops — Another Way to Get Free Warframe Rewards

Twitch drops are separate from standard codes but work alongside them. Watch Warframe Devstreams and partner events on Twitch. You can earn exclusive items and cosmetics by doing so.

To activate Twitch drops:

  1. Link your Warframe and Twitch accounts at warframe.com/twitch
  2. Watch any eligible Warframe stream
  3. Claim your drop from the Twitch drops inventory page
  4. Rewards are delivered to your in-game inbox
